Back To The Dust Bowl - Back To Work
There's a funny moment on the new Woody Guthrie CD. My mom and dad are on stage and he's been going off on some wild tangential tale, and she's trying to bring him back to the subject at hand. She says, "back to the dust bowl," and he says "back to work." That exchange has now become part of the family lingo as a way of saying to get back on subject... It may be funnier in our family than others.
